SUNY Empire State College Signs Partnership with Long Island Educational Opportunity Center

Partnership paves the way for Long Island EOC students, graduates, employees, and their family members to earn an online bachelor’s degree through SUNY Empire

(FARMINGDALE, NEW YORK, December 7, 2021) SUNY Empire State College and Long Island Educational Opportunity Center (Long Island EOC), finalized a partnership agreement offering college degree options to the program’s students, graduates, employees and their family members. Long Island EOC provides Long Island residents with innovative academic and vocational training programs leading to gainful employment and economic self-sufficiency. 

The partnership agreement allows Long Island EOC participants to participate in SUNY Empire’s Corporate and Community Partnership Benefits Program. As part of the agreement, SUNY Empire will waive the orientation fee for incoming students and provide a $100 Better Together scholarship for participants who enroll in a degree-seeking program at SUNY Empire State College.

All programs can be completed entirely online to fit the busy lives of working students. Participants will also benefit from SUNY Empire’s prior learning assessment, which awards college credit for relevant work and life experience, reducing the overall cost and time needed to complete a degree.

Long Island EOC participants may also qualify to apply for admission to one of SUNY Empire’s opportunity programs, which provide academic and/or financial support to underserved students who show promise for college success. SUNY Empire’s opportunity programs serve students at all stages of life and learning, full or part time.
